Community Development Block Grant Program
Background
The US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) provides annual grants on a formula basis to entitled cities and counties to develop viable urban communities by providing decent housing and a suitable living environment, and by expanding economic opportunities, principally for low and moderate income persons. These grants are called Community Development Block Grants or CDBG. The City of Arvada has received these grants since 1975 which has enabled the City to provide a large array of vital public improvements and services to low and moderate income households and older neighborhoods
The Annual Action Plan for the use of 2009 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) funding allocated funding to two primary programs which include the Essential Home Repairs Program and the City Human Services Funding Pool.
